Camps and activities for Years 7-10
The final weeks of Term 2 were filled with opportunities for students to challenge themselves, strengthen friendships, and celebrate a successful semester.
Following the completion of assessment and the commencement of holidays for senior students, a range of programs, camps, and excursions were organised for students in Years 7 to 10, providing a positive and engaging conclusion to the term.
In Week 19, MacKillop’s youngest cohort visited Collaroy for the Year 7 Camp, where they embraced a variety of activities designed to build confidence, leadership, and teamwork. From high ropes and vertical challenges to archery and the giant swing, students stepped outside their comfort zones while developing new friendships and strengthening existing ones.
At the same time, Year 8 students participated in a two-day program focused on personal growth and wellbeing. The program featured the Rock and Water initiative, Coastlife-led team challenges, and a First Aid and CPR presentation delivered by ACTWELL, equipping students with valuable life skills and practical knowledge.
For Year 9, the focus was firmly on the future. Students spent two days at the St Peter’s Campus taking part in the YLead Program and a transition experience designed to support their move to Isabella Plains in 2027. The activities encouraged students to build confidence and prepare for the next stage of their school journey.
Week 20 saw Year 10 students travel to Sydney to take part in the Urban Challenge, an interactive adventure that required teams to navigate the city while completing a series of engaging activities. As part of the experience, students also contributed to the community through either the Cook4Good or Our Big Kitchen programs, preparing nutritious meals for people experiencing homelessness and food insecurity. Back on campus, students participated in Reflection Day and Course Counselling sessions as they began planning for senior studies.
These experiences provided valuable opportunities for students to learn, connect, and grow beyond the classroom.
